Universities in Nigeria with Lower Cut-Off Marks for Geophysics

Sponsored Links

Geophysics is an exciting field that explores the Earth’s physical properties.

If you’re interested in this dynamic discipline but concerned about competitive entry requirements, fret not

This blog post explores seven Nigerian universities offering Geophysics degrees with relatively lower cut-off marks

1. Federal University of Technology, Owerri (FUTO)

FUTO boasts a renowned geosciences department offering a top-notch Geophysics program. The university sets a cut-off mark of around 190 for admission, making it accessible to aspiring geophysicists.

2. Federal University of Petroleum Resources Effurun (FUPRE)

Given its focus on petroleum resources, FUPRE places high importance on Geophysics. With a cut-off mark of around 185, the university offers a program tailored to the oil and gas industry, making it ideal for those seeking careers in this specific sector.

3. Enugu State University of Science and Technology (ESUT)

This specialized university offers a strong Geophysics program with a cut-off mark of around 180. ESUT’s focus on science and technology fosters a dynamic learning environment for geophysics students.

4. Ibrahim Badamasi Babangida University, Lapai (IBBUL)

IBBUL provides a Geophysics program with a cut-off mark of around 190. The university’s location places it close to geologically significant areas, offering potential for valuable field experiences.

5. Adeyemi University, Oyo (Adeyemi Uni)

Nestled in Oyo State, Adeyemi Uni offers a Geophysics program with a cut-off mark of around 185. The university’s serene environment fosters a focused learning atmosphere for students.

6. Umaru Musa Yar’adua University, Katsina (UMYU)

UMYU presents a Geophysics program with a cut-off mark of around 190. Situated in northern Nigeria, the university provides a unique opportunity to explore the region’s distinct geological features.

7. Federal University, Oye-Ekiti (FUOYE)

FUOYE offers a Geophysics program with a cut-off mark of around 180. The university’s emphasis on research creates a stimulating environment for students seeking a well-rounded geophysics education.

What subjects are important for admission into Geophysics programs?

Physics, Chemistry, and Mathematics are typically the core requirements. Some universities may also consider Geography or Further Mathematics.

What career options are available with a Geophysics degree?

Geophysics graduates can find careers in oil and gas exploration, mineral exploration, environmental consulting, and disaster risk reduction, among others.
